eye-grep tagger — deberta-v3-small
The accuracy-first tagger for eye-grep, a log colorizer that highlights ids,
timestamps, IPs and repeated strings in server logs. It is a token classifier
that labels each content token of a log line with one of 11 tags, letting a renderer
color site-specific id formats it has never seen before.
Fine-tuned from
microsoft/deberta-v3-small (SentencePiece). This is the champion
model — highest accuracy, larger download — and the eye-grep
CLI loads it by
default. For an in-browser build use the smaller, distilled
opsbr/eye-grep-electra-small.
Tag schema (11 classes)
PUNCT WORD NUM RAND IP DURATION SIZE TIMESTAMP LEVEL URL PATH
RAND is a high-entropy id (uuid / hash / token); NUM, SIZE, DURATION are
numeric values; TIMESTAMP, IP, URL, PATH, LEVEL are self-explanatory;
WORD/PUNCT are ordinary text.
Files
ONNX in the transformers.js layout — onnx/model.onnx (fp32) and
onnx/model_quantized.onnx (int8, the default) — plus the SentencePiece tokenizer.

Training data
Fine-tuned on the synthetic, fully-owned
opsbr/eye-grep gold set
(Apache-2.0) — deterministically generated, no third-party log data.
Notes
- Int8 dynamic quantization costs only ~0.002 usefulness versus fp32.
- The tokenizer mirrors eye-grep's frozen
train/spec.py; the model's subword
predictions are aligned back onto content-token spans at inference time.
